Security and Issuer. ------ ------------------- This statement relates to the common stock, par value $0.01 per share (the "Shares"), of Datawatch Corporation (the "Issuer"), a Delaware corporation, whose principal executive offices are located at 175 Cabot Street, Suite 503, Lowell, Massachusetts 01854. Item 2. Identity and Background. ------ ----------------------- This Form 13-D is filed on behalf of Richard de J. Osborne (the "Reporting Person"). The Reporting Person's business address is 40 East 94th Street, Apt. No. 18D, New York, New York 10128. The Reporting Person is the Chairman of the Board of Directors of the Issuer. The Reporting Person is the Managing Principal of Carnegie Hill Associates,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company ("CHA"). The principal business of CHA is investing in securities of public and private companies. The address of CHA's principal business office is 40 East 94th Street, Apt. No. 18D, New York, New York 10128. The Reporting Person and CHA may be deemed to be a "group" within the meaning of Section 13d(3) of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ended, and Rule 13d-5(b) thereunder. However, the Reporting Person disclaims beneficial ownership of CHA's Shares except to the extent of his pecuniary interest therein. Sources and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ration. ------ -------------------------------------------------- The Reporting Person acquired 71,685 Shares through CHA at a purchase price per share of $2.79, after giving effect to a 1:4.5 reverse stock split that occurred on July 23, 2001 (the "Reverse Stock Split"). The source of funds was CHA's available capital. The Reporting Person received 44,112 Shares from the Issuer at an average purchase price per share of $1.21, after giving effect to the Reverse Stock Split, as consideration for advisory services provided to the Issuer. The Reporting Person purchased 17,066 Shares on the open market out of this personal funds, at an average purchase price of $2.11 per Share, after giving effect to the Reverse Stock Split. Item 4. Purpose of Transaction. ------ ---------------------- On January 12, 2001, CHA purchased 71,685 Shares, after giving effect to the Reverse Stock Split, from the Issuer in a private transaction exempt from the registration requirements of the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the "2001 Transaction"). Under the Investment Agreement, dated as of January 12, 2001, among the Issuer, WC Capital LLC ("WC Capital") and CHA (the "Investment Agreement"), CHA was granted certain demand, piggyback and Form S-3 registration rights and certain preemptive rights. The purchase of Shares by CHA was for investment purposes. The Reporting Person received 44,112 Shares, after giving effect to the Reverse Stock Split, as consideration for advisory services provided to the Issuer. The Shares purchased by the Reporting Person on the open market were purchased for investment purposes. Contracts, Arrangements, Understandings or Relationships with Respect to Securities of the Issuer. --------------------------------------- Under the Investment Agreement, CHA was granted a preemptive right to purchase additional Shares in the event that the Issuer offers, sells or otherwise issues new Shares in a public or private transaction, so long as CHA holds at least 25% of the Shares purchased in the 2001 Transaction. In addition, pursuant to the Investment Agreement, subject to certain conditions, WC Capital will have the right to include, as nominees for the Issuer's board of directors, two directors. Pursuant to such rights, WC Capital designated the Reporting Person as Chairman of the board of directors of the Issuer. Concurrently with the consummation of the 2001 Transaction, the Reporting Person was elected as a director of the Issuer and as Chairman of the board or directors of the Issuer.
